Ondo APC Primaries: No rift with governor over party flag bearers – Olabimtan

Hon. Victor Olabimtan

Published By Olukayode Idowu

The former Speaker, Ondo State House of Assembly, Hon. Victor Olabimtan has said that there is no rift between him and Governor Oluwarotimi Akeredolu, over party candidates for the coming general elections, contrary to the news making the rounds.

The confusion, according to findings, has to do with who will be the flag bearer of the APC in Akoko South West Local Government Constituency 2.

The slot it was gathered has been micro-zoned to Supare, one of the communities based on the unwritten rotational agreement.  The current occupant in the State House of Assembly is from Ikun Akoko.

However, the people of Supare became agitated when the preferred aspirant of the party, Mrs. Akeju Bukunmi Oseyemi is an Oba Akoko indigene by marriage, though from Supare. She is also said to be unknown in Supare, her place of birth as all her political activities had always been in Oba Akoko.

Olabimtan, according to findings, only stepped in to douse the tension and assure them that the governor and the party’s choice would be the best for the entire people.

Besides, it was also noted that like a father figure, he blessed all the aspirants that came to meet him for blessing and which some people termed to be supporting other candidates different from the ones the governor is supporting.

He therefore said there was never a time either in the open or in secret that he disagreed with the governor or the party over who flies the flag of the party. 

The former Ondo State House of Assembly Speaker, said contrary to what mischief makers want people to believe, he has always been in tandem with the position of the governor and always working to ensure the party comes out top in every contest.

He said, “I am not at loggerhead with Mr. Governor and neither are we working at cross purposes. I have always supported the decision of the party.”

He therefore said that the report was a figment of  imagination of the writer.

The politician also stated in a statement signed by his media aide, Mr. Adeyemi Ayodele that at no point did he endorse a different candidates for Akoko South West Constituency 11.

He said he would have ignored the report but for several calls by party supporters.
